The most common and recent 5-letter answer for "Crazy Horse's people" is SIOUX.

Crazy Horse was a famous leader of the Oglala Lakota, which is part of the Sioux tribes. The clue refers to his affiliation with the Sioux people, a group of Native American tribes known for their rich history and culture.

This clue was last seen in the NYT Crossword on January 05, 2026.

Sioux refers to a group of Native American tribes and First Nations peoples in North America, including the Dakota, Lakota, and Nakota.
